Understanding Roblox’s Moderation System

Roblox employs a multi-layered moderation system to combat inappropriate content. This includes automated filtering, human moderators, and community reporting mechanisms. The platform utilizes sophisticated algorithms to detect and flag potentially offensive language, including variations and misspellings. Human moderators then review flagged content and take appropriate action, which can range from warnings to account suspensions.

The Role of Automated Filtering

Automated filtering plays a critical role in the initial screening process. These systems are designed to identify and block specific words and phrases deemed offensive or inappropriate. However, these filters are not perfect and can sometimes miss subtle forms of offensive language or, conversely, flag innocent words.

The Significance of Human Moderation

Human moderators are essential for reviewing flagged content and making nuanced judgments. They can assess context, intent, and the overall impact of the language used. This human element is crucial for handling complex situations and ensuring fairness in moderation decisions.

Community Reporting: Empowering Users

Roblox empowers its users to report inappropriate content. This allows players to actively participate in maintaining a safe environment. Reporting tools are readily available, and reports are reviewed by moderators who take appropriate action.

Protecting Children: Parental Guidance and Support

Parents play a vital role in ensuring their children’s safety on Roblox. Open communication, setting clear expectations, and utilizing parental control features are essential.

Open Communication: Talking to Your Children

Talk to your children about online safety and the importance of respectful communication. Encourage them to report any instances of offensive language or inappropriate behavior they encounter.

Setting Clear Expectations: Rules and Boundaries

Establish clear rules and boundaries for your children’s online activity. This includes setting limits on screen time, monitoring their online interactions, and discussing the consequences of inappropriate behavior.

Utilizing Parental Control Features on Roblox

Roblox offers a range of parental control features that can help protect children. These features allow parents to restrict access to certain content, monitor chat logs, and set privacy settings.

What happens if my child accidentally uses offensive language?

Roblox typically issues warnings for first-time offenses. Subsequent violations may result in account suspensions or bans, depending on the severity.

How can I report offensive language I see on Roblox?

You can report offensive language by using the in-game reporting tools or contacting Roblox directly through their support channels.

Are there specific words that Roblox censors?

Yes, Roblox has a comprehensive list of words and phrases that are automatically censored. This list is constantly updated to include new offensive terms.

How does Roblox handle different languages?

Roblox employs language detection and translation tools to moderate content in multiple languages. They strive to create a safe environment for users worldwide.
